Dr. Gregory Cusano, DO is a hematopathology specialist in Fort Worth, TX and has over 28 years of experience in the medical field. He graduated from Nova Southeastern University Dr. Kiran C. Patel College of Allopathic Medicine in 1995. He is affiliated with Texas Health Specialty Hospital. He is accepting new patients.
